Falcons 2018 draft class gets a B grade from NFL.com

Falcons general manager Thomas Dimitroff has done a solid job of building his team through the NFL draft. While injuries derailed the team in 2018, it remains a strong and well-rounded roster that should remain competitive for several years, at least.

In last year’s draft, Dimitroff added a few more players who are likely to be serious contributors or at least long-term starters. Calvin Ridley is the star of the group, but Deadrin Senat, Foye Oluokun and Ito Smith all showed some promise, as well. Over at NFL.com, Jeremy Bergman has given the Falcons a “B” grade for the draft class.

“The Falcons reaped solid contributors in Oluokun, Senat, Oliver and Smith, the last of whom filled in nicely for injured RB Devonta Freeman and perhaps won a part-time gig in Atlanta’s backfield next season. Ridley, Senat and Oluokun could be starters in 2019, but that depends on how the Falcons attack the market.”

Oliver should also be projected to start at cornerback opposite Desmond Trufant now that Robert Alford is out of the picture.

Getting four or five potential starters in one draft class is an excellent haul. Hats off to Dimitroff for another good year.
